Understanding the Function of the Window Motor in Your Mazda CX-7

In the 2011 Mazda CX-7, the driver-side window motor powers the movement of the window up and down. It forms an integral part of the window regulator system, including cables, pulleys, and other mechanisms.

The motor receives electrical signals from the window switch, converting them into mechanical energy that drives the window along its track. This setup ensures smooth and efficient window operation. The motor’s function is critical for convenience and safety, allowing the driver to adjust the window effortlessly.  Understanding this mechanism can aid in diagnosing potential issues and maintaining the vehicle’s overall functionality.

How the 2011 Mazda CX 7 Driver Side Window Regulator: An In-Depth Look

The 2011 Mazda CX 7 driver side window regulator collaborates with the window motor to facilitate the movement of the window glass. Upon activation of the window switch, an electrical current is sent to the motor, causing it to rotate. This rotational motion is transmitted to the window regulator via cables and gears. The regulator acts as a guide, ensuring the window travels smoothly along its intended path without obstruction or misalignment.

The construction of the window regulator typically includes robust components such as cables and pulleys, which are designed to handle the repetitive motion required for window operation. Proper alignment and lubrication of these parts are crucial for maintaining the regulator’s performance. Additionally, the system must be free from debris and dirt to avoid wear and tear that can hinder its functionality.

A well-functioning window regulator is essential not only for convenience but also for the vehicle’s structural integrity. Misalignment or damage can lead to problems such as the window becoming stuck or moving erratically. Understanding the interplay between the motor and regulator can help identify issues early and ensure the smooth operation of the vehicle’s window system.

Common Issues with Window Motors?

Window motors in vehicles such as the 2011 Mazda CX-7 are prone to several common issues. One frequent problem is sluggish window movement, where the window raises or lowers slower than usual. This can be caused by worn-out motor or window regulator system components.

Another issue is unusual noises during operation, which might indicate mechanical wear or debris interfering with the motor’s function. The window may become stuck in one position due to motor failure or an obstruction within the regulator. Electrical issues, such as faulty wiring or a malfunctioning window switch, can also impact the motor’s performance.

If the motor is intermittently working or not responding, it may be due to a poor electrical connection. Regular inspection and maintenance can help identify these issues early, preventing more significant problems and ensuring the window system operates smoothly.

Diagnosing 2011 Mazda CX 7 Window Motor Problems

Diagnosing 2011 Mazda CX 7 window motor involves a methodical approach to identifying the root cause of the issue. Essential tools for this process include a multimeter, a screwdriver, and a basic socket set.

The diagnosis starts with inspecting the window switch to confirm it functions correctly. Following this, the electrical connections to the motor should be tested using a multimeter to verify that the motor is receiving power. If the connections are intact and power reaches the motor, the next step is to examine the motor for signs of wear, damage, or burnout.

Another aspect to consider is the condition of the window regulator, as its malfunction can affect the motor’s operation. Look for obstructions, misalignments, or mechanical wear within the regulator system. If the motor receives power but does not operate, the motor likely needs replacement.

Additionally, checking the vehicle’s fuse box for any blown fuses related to the window motor circuit can help identify electrical issues. Following these diagnostic steps can assist in accurately pinpointing the cause of the problem, enabling efficient repairs or replacements.

Step-by-Step Guide to 2011 Mazda CX7 Window Motor Replacement

Replacing the 2011 Mazda cx7 window motor replacement involves several steps and requires tools such as a screwdriver set, a socket set, and the replacement motor. The process starts by disconnecting the vehicle’s battery to ensure safety.

Next, the door panel must be carefully removed, which involves locating and removing screws and clips that secure it in place. Once the door panel is off, the faulty motor can be detached from the window regulator. This involves disconnecting any electrical connections and unbolting the motor from its mounting.

The new motor is then installed by reversing these steps. Ensuring that all electrical connections are secure and the motor is correctly aligned with the regulator is essential. After the new motor is in place, the door panel can be reattached by securing the screws and clips.

Finally, the battery should be reconnected, and the window operation tested to confirm the successful installation of the new motor. Ensuring that the window moves smoothly without issues indicates a proper installation.

Maintenance Tips for Prolonging 2011 Mazda cx7 Window Regulator Life

Proper maintenance of the 2011 Mazda cx7 window regulator can extend its lifespan and ensure smooth operation. Regular cleaning of the window tracks is essential to prevent the accumulation of dirt and debris, which can hinder movement and cause wear. A suitable lubricant on the tracks and moving parts can reduce friction and ensure the window operates smoothly. It’s essential to use a lubricant designed for automotive purposes to avoid damage to the components.

It is also crucial to avoid unnecessary strain on the window motor. Repeatedly operating the window without allowing the motor to rest can lead to overheating and premature failure. Ensuring that the window is fully open or closed before using the motor can prevent unnecessary stress on the system. Regularly inspecting the window regulator for signs of wear, such as frayed cables or worn pulleys, can help identify potential issues early. Addressing these problems promptly can prevent further damage and maintain the regulator’s efficiency.

Additionally, ensuring that the window motor’s electrical connections are secure and corrosion-free can help maintain proper functionality. Periodic checks of the vehicle’s fuse box for any blown fuses related to the window motor circuit can also be beneficial. Taking these preventive measures can significantly enhance the longevity and reliability of the window regulator system.
